Come savor "Bosley" - a great 2 bedroom, 2 bath, oceanfront condo at the William & Mary complex in Carolina Beach. The living room and kitchen are oceanfront, while both bedrooms are street side. The cavernous first bedroom boosts a Queen bed, street side deck, private bathroom with double sinks and flat screen TV. The second bedroom is ideal for the kids with a bunk bed boasting a Twin bed over a Full bed, flat screen TV and an attached full bathroom. There is a also a sleeper couch in the living room.

Indoors you'll find everything you need for a comfortable and calming stay. Sit outside and appreciate the ocean breezes and vistas on the oceanfront deck, a great spot for outdoor dining and sunbathing. A private walkway to the beach and an outside shower are located at the rear of the building.

Savor oceanfront vistas on the fashionable north end of Carolina Beach, NC at the William and Mary condo complex. Each William and Mary unit offers two bedrooms and is in close proximity to the eateries, bars, stores, and Carolina Beach Boardwalk. This complex is conveniently located between the beach and the canal, where you will find calm waters and kayak access. Appreciate the complex’s private beach access and spend the day on the sand. The Carolina Beach Pier is only blocks to the north, where you can spend the afternoon fishing in the striking Atlantic Ocean! In the evening, head down to the Boardwalk for live music, fireworks, and fantastic dining.

Carolina Beach is located on the southern tip of North Carolina, on photogenic Pleasure Island. This family-friendly beach is ideal for surfing, fishing and collecting seashells.

"Bosley" is located just seven blocks north of the Boardwalk area in downtown Carolina Beach. You are within walking distance to stores, eateries and the summer activities such as fireworks, carnival rides and live music. Watch the fishermen come in with the catch of the day at the marina or dine out with the family. Make plans to visit Carolina Beach today!

How to book the best rental home experience:

When to visit & When to book:

  • To get the most suitable vacation home within budget, we strongly suggest booking in the Fall or Spring. You'll benefit from lower rental rates, greater selection, gorgeous weather and the absence of giant crowds at Wilmington, NC restaurants, beaches, and activities. Speaking of the off-season, don't overlook Winter holidays for a Wilmington, NC vacation! Who wouldn't love a holiday vacation near the ocean? Thanksgiving and Christmas are great times to gather with loved ones at the beach.
  • The sooner your group can book a rental home, the better your selection will be. The most desirable rental homes are reserved very early. Reserving your rental home 6-12 months before your vacation dates is recommended. Winter holidays are excellent times to plan and reserve your vacation home.
  • Hosts and Property managers sometimes offer special rates for veterans. Remember to ask your host or property manager if special discounts are available for your group.
  • Booking websites frequently offer renters an option to purchase trip insurance protection. Trip insurance, which commonly will cost between 1% - 5% of the base reservation price, offers visitors reimbursement of their vacation costs for missed time as a result of personal medical-related emergencies or weather, as well as hurricane evacuation charges, such as an unexpected hotel stay or extra fuel expenses. Trip insurance is definitely a life-saver if the unforeseen happens. Ask your host for program terms and fees.
  • Find a copy of your local visitors guide when you check-in. If your rental doesn't have one, you can find them at local grocery stores and visitor centers. In addition to great local articles, visitors guide magazines contain coupons for local accommodations, restaurants and tours.

Advice for your stay:

  • Take a copy of the owner's contact number and entry/exit procedures for your rental. Put the manager's information in your smartphone and wallet.
  • Make a record of any issues with the rental at check in, and immediately send them to the host. We specifically recommend texts and e-mails, as they usually contain built-in time stamps that can be valuable if damages are assessed.
  • Ask questions. You may want instructions for a garage door opener, elevator or washer/dryer. Contact your owner. They are there to help! A brief call prevents lots of problems.
  • Be a good neighbor! You wouldn't like obnoxious visitors bothering your peaceful home. Use the golden rule for common sense. Happy residents may even recommend great restaurants and scenic spots you would've never otherwise known about!
  • Speaking of neighbors... Ask a local resident! Locals can frequently help you find the best spots in town. Who better to ask where to launch your kayaks, have a great night on the town, or the best spots for crabbing?
  • Lock your vacation home while you're out. Keep your property safe!
  • When it's time to leave, take a walk-through to make sure you didn't leave anything behind. Check bathrooms, garages, and back yards for hidden belongings. Clean the refrigerator and take any leftovers home.
  • Record a video to document the condition of the property.
  • Did you have a terrific time? Most rental managers make it easy for guests to provide comments. If your property and/or property management company was terrific, they always love to hear your praise. If anything was out of order and they failed to address it within reason, or if the vacation rental wasn't described correctly, you'll want to make a note as part of your comments.

Victory Beach Vacations

Visitors who are on the hunt for the postcard-perfect vacation rental in the heart of the Carolina Beach or Kure Beach area will find an enticing selection and plenty of friendly customer service when they rent through Victory Beach Vacations. Based in Carolina Beach in the coastal Cape Fear region, Victory Beach Vacations has more than 100 vacation rentals in all shapes and sizes to ensure that every vacationing family can find their dream home away from home on the beach.   When you book your Cape Fear getaway with Victory Beach Vacations, the fun doesn’t end when you leave the beach, it continues with an array of privately-owned properties outfitted with all of the amenities needed for a fabulous beach vacation.   Jenna Lanier, General Manager, explains that her family first opened the rental and property management business in 2002. At the forefront of Victory Beach operations is Lanier’s mother, Caroline Meeks. Meeks is both the Broker in Charge and co-owner with husband, Buck Meeks, who manages the Field Services team with Lanier’s husband, Scott.   For nearly 20 years, the Victory Beach team has worked tirelessly to establish a network of top-of-the-line rental properties for Cape Fear visitors to enjoy. “As far as our properties go,” explains Lanier, “they are all updated, well-furnished and appointed. “We have always performed post-cleaning inspections and since the pandemic, have put freshly laundered duvets over all of the comforters between rentals.”   Lanier emphasizes how important the guests experience is “we strive to give our guests a relaxing, stress free, memorable vacation.” This emphasis on customer service has led to Victory Beach Vacations having a 4.8 Google rating with over 300 reviews by happy owners and guests.In addition to Victory Beach’s superior sanitation practices, the company offers properties for every type of visitor. Choose from luxury oceanfront houses and condos to more reasonbly priced 2nd row properties with oceanviews. Many properties include pools and hot tubs as well, perfect for outdoor entertaining, and many are dog friendly.   Lanier also notes that all properties are within walking or driving distance to Pleasure Island’s main attractions – Carolina Beach and Kure Beach. The former, as described by Lanier, is the more commercialized of the two destinations and features a boardwalk, outdoor dining options and a plethora of weekly activities including fireworks, live music, amusement park pop-ups, and movies under the stars. Kure Beach offers a more residential feel with its fishing pier, intimate restaurants and family favorite, North Carolina Aquarium at Fort Fisher.More water fun awaits, too. “There is a harbor and a canal that feed into the intercoastal. We have several properties on the harbor so guests can bring their boat, kayak, [or jet ski] and travel between islands,” says Lanier.   A stay with Victory Beach Vacations is an annual pilgrimage for most. “A large percentage of guests are previous guests. Some even reserve the same property for the next year as they’re checking out,” Lanier says. “It’s almost like it’s their personal vacation home.”   Even before guests arrive at their vacation destination, the Victory Beach Vacations’ website greets them with a live beach cam and exquisite aerial footage of both Carolina and Kure Beaches.
